Repointing and also Tuckpointing are associated forms of brickwork fixing. The primary distinction is that repointing involves the removal and also replacement of a used out mortar layer around existing bricks as well as the resetting of blocks where needed. In contrast, tuckpointing entails the removal as well as replacement of deteriorated mortar just, while leaving the blocks intact.

Tuckpointing is a term used to refer to a type of mortar joint repair work, occasionally referred to as repointing. Tuckpointing is required since it secures the mortar joints that with time become loose, broken, as well as or else endangered.

When the mortar joints come to be endangered, the stonework will certainly struggle with moisture intrusion, as well as be exposed to other dangers, such as bacteria that can trigger degeneration and also rot. In extreme instances, tuckpointing can be essential to conserve a wall surface or masonry structure from further damage. In addition to protecting the masonry framework, tuckpointing can additionally be necessary to ensure the visual allure of the framework.



Sometimes, simply cleaning the existing mortar joints can be sufficient to boost the structure's honesty and also appearance. In other instances, a lot more comprehensive tuckpointing might be needed in order to repair the mortar joints and recover the masonry to its initial condition. Regardless, if a masonry framework is enduring from mortar joint damages, a professional must be gotten in touch with to identify the best approach for repair work.
